Local tips

  • Arrive early in the day to enjoy quieter waters and the best views.
  • Check the weather conditions beforehand to ensure a safe paddleboarding experience.
  • Bring sunscreen and a hat, as the sun can be strong even on cloudy days.
  • Consider booking a guided tour for a more informative experience about the local environment.
  • Wear water shoes for better grip and comfort while paddling.

Getting There

  • Walking

    Start your journey at the Port St Mary Harbour. From the harbour, head east along the promenade, enjoying the beautiful views of the coastline. Continue walking until you reach the end of the promenade, where you will see a sign for the coastal path. Follow the coastal path, which will lead you towards the village of Port Erin. After approximately 1.5 miles, you will reach the edge of Port Erin. As you enter the village, follow the path that leads you to Station Road. Once on Station Road, keep walking for about 0.3 miles, and you will find Port Erin Paddleboards located at 36PW+384, Station Rd, Port Erin, Isle of Man IM9 6AP.

  • Bus

    From Port St Mary, walk to the nearest bus stop located on the main road (A7). Board the bus heading towards Port Erin. The journey is approximately 10 minutes. Once you arrive in Port Erin, disembark at the bus stop on Station Road. From there, walk a short distance down Station Road (about 0.1 miles) and you will find Port Erin Paddleboards at 36PW+384, Station Rd, Port Erin, Isle of Man IM9 6AP.

  • Cycling

    If you have access to a bicycle, you can cycle from Port St Mary to Port Erin. Start by heading towards the promenade and then follow the coastal path as you would if walking. The cycling route is the same as the walking route, approximately 1.5 miles. Once you reach Port Erin, cycle along Station Road, and you will arrive at Port Erin Paddleboards located at 36PW+384, Station Rd, Port Erin, Isle of Man IM9 6AP.
